Creamy Broccoli, Cauliflower, and Cheese Soup Recipe

Description

Hearty Broccoli, Cauliflower, and Cheese Soup delivers comfort in a bowl, blending creamy textures with robust vegetable flavors. Rich cheese and tender vegetables create a warm, satisfying meal perfect for chilly evenings.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 cups (710 ml) broccoli florets, fresh
  • 3 cups (710 ml) cauliflower florets, fresh
  • 1 cup (240 ml) carrots, diced (about 2 medium to large)
  • 1 cup (240 ml) celery, diced (about 2 large ribs)
  • 1 cup (240 ml) onion, diced (about 1 small to medium)
  • 2 cups (470 ml) cheddar cheese, sharp, shredded
  • 1 cup (240 ml) half and half
  • 4 cups (950 ml) water
  • 4 tsp chicken base (such as Better Than Bouillon)
  • 2 tbsps olive oil (regular or light, not extra virgin)
  • 3 tbsps all-purpose flour
  • Salt, to taste
  • Pepper, to taste

Instructions

  1. Aromatics Preparation: Warm ol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Sauté diced carrots, celery, and onions with salt and pepper, allowing vegetables to soften and develop rich flavors for 5 minutes.
  2. Roux Creation: Dust flour over the vegetable medley, stirring consistently to form a smooth, integrated base. Toast the mixture for one minute to eliminate raw flour taste.
  3. Liquid Foundation: Combine chicken base with water, then pour into the pot along with broccoli and cauliflower florets. Bring the mixture to a robust boil, then immediately reduce to a gentle simmer.
  4. Vegetable Transformation: Cover the pot and let vegetables tenderize for 10 minutes. Use a potato masher to break down ingredients, creating a rustic texture that balances between chunky and smooth.
  5. Creamy Finale: Remove from heat and fold in half and half, then gradually incorporate shredded cheddar cheese until a luxurious, velvety consistency develops. Adjust seasoning with additional salt and pepper to taste.
  6. Serving Presentation: Transfer the steaming soup into serving bowls. Optionally, garnish with a sprinkle of extra cheese or fresh herbs to elevate both visual appeal and flavor profile.

Notes

  • Vegetable Prep Tip: Dice carrots, celery, and onions uniformly to ensure even cooking and consistent texture throughout the soup.
  • Flour Technique: Stir flour thoroughly to prevent lumps and create a smooth, silky base that thickens the soup naturally.
  • Cheese Melting Hack: Add cheese gradually off direct heat to prevent separation and maintain a creamy, smooth consistency.
  • Texture Balancing Trick: Use a potato masher strategically to create a rustic, hearty soup with a perfect blend of chunky and smooth elements.
